Doria Ragland set to celebrate milestone 70th birthday without Meghan Markle and Prince Harry

Doria Ragland will celebrate her 70th birthday on September 2, marking the milestone just after her family crossed the Atlantic.

Her daughter Meghan Markle, son-in-law Prince Harry, and grandchildren Prince Archie, seven, and Princess Lilibet, five, left California and settled in Britain last week, where the children will begin attending English schools this month.


For the past six years, Ms Ragland has served as the family’s emotional anchor and a constant figure in their daily lives, ever since the Duke and Duchess of Sussex relinquished their roles as senior working royals and moved to the United States in 2020.

The devoted grandmother currently resides in a bungalow in an affluent neighbourhood on the outskirts of Los Angeles, situated less than two hours’ drive from the Sussexes’ Montecito estate.

Her steadfast support has earned Ms Ragland the description of a “rock” during the turbulent period when the couple departed royal duties and established themselves in California.

A royal source has revealed that Harry has become exceptionally close to his mother-in-law, who has proved a “tower of strength” for the pair.

A source previously told The Sun: “Harry obviously doesn’t have a mum whom he can turn to for advice, but he has always been incredibly close to Doria and never more so than now.”

The Duke himself called Ragland “amazing” during a BBC interview announcing his engagement. A former confidant of hers told the Mail on Sunday: “She is like the Queen – she never complains and never explains.”

This bond has endured throughout Harry’s estrangement from his brother and Meghan’s breakdown in communication with her father, Thomas Markle.

Ms Ragland is expected to keep her West Coast home as a base while travelling regularly to visit the family in Britain.

According to TMZ insiders, she will remain close to the couple’s American property, where she reportedly has a dedicated “granny flat” within the Montecito mansion. Her wide circle of friends in California provides further reason to stay rooted there.

Her importance as a grandparent was evident in September 2022, when she looked after Archie, then three, and Lilibet, then one, at the Montecito home while the Sussexes were stranded in Britain following Queen Elizabeth II’s death.

The couple had been in the UK for engagements and ended up staying for the funeral, a three-week absence that Meghan later described on her Netflix programme as leaving her feeling “not well”.

Ms Ragland, a social worker and yoga instructor by profession, has largely shunned public attention since sitting alone in a pew at the 2018 Windsor Castle wedding, the sole representative from Meghan’s side of the family, after Thomas Markle did not attend.

Meghan has described her mother as a “free spirit” and spoken publicly about drawing strength from her example.

“I find inspiration in the strong women around me. Of course, my mother being one of them,” the Duchess told an Afro Women and Power Forum in Colombia.

Despite her privacy preference, Ms Ragland has appeared in family moments shared by her daughter, including a Mother’s Day outing to Disneyland in Anaheim in May and footage from January showing her swimming with Lilibet in the California sunshine.
